As nouns, syncytium is a hyponym of cytol; that is, syncytium is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than cytol:
  • cytol: the protoplasm of a cell excluding the nucleus; is full of proteins that control cell metabolism
  • syncytium: a mass of cytoplasm containing several nuclei and enclosed in a membrane but no internal cell boundaries (as in muscle fibers)
